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7904593 527 96720389
20317 4022946 33340438
20317 4022946 33340438
687 18425 492144359 817953872 756614
All about undefined
Interested in learning more?
20317 4022946 33340438
687 18425 492144359 817953872 756614
See more
5648669312 85821324859
2911423 81624567 2583200
See more
65033 83
97 741 73327878996 274
See more